Output ae411753d05e6097aac84ad019772202ae18ef64ad5f61480dea0a1940108867:631

value
1626
script pubkey
OP_0 OP_PUSHBYTES_20 6b365cea91679fec0b754eb6efb1803f9be095e5
address
bc1qdvm9e653v707czm4f6mwlvvq87d7p909uat6m4
transaction
ae411753d05e6097aac84ad019772202ae18ef64ad5f61480dea0a1940108867
confirmations
236497
spent
true